NOTE:
1
The width of the cuff is either approximately 40% of the limb circumference or 2/3 of
the upper arm length. The inflatable part of the cuff should be long enough to encircle
80-100% of the limb. The wrong size of cuff can cause erroneous readings. If the cuff
size is in question, use another cuff with suitable size to avoid errors.
2
If an NIBP measurement is suspect, repeat the measurement. If you are still
uncertain about the reading, use another method to measure the blood pressure.
3
Please make sure the cuff is well connected. A leak of air may cause measurement
error.
4
Please select the cuff with the suitable size. An unsuitable cuff may cause incorrect
measurements.
5
Avoid incursion of liquid into the cuff. If this happens, please desiccate the cuff
completely.
6
NIBP parameter area can display real-time cuff pressure value till displaying SYS
value.
7
NIBP parameter area keeps measured value for 30 mins. If there is no measurement
to continue, the area will display invalid value after 30 mins.
